try this

1. Restart the computer.

2. Repeatedly tap the F8 key until you see the Advanced Boot Option Screen.

3. Select Repair Your Computerand hit Enter.

4. Select your country >> OK.

5. On the System Recovery Options Screen select Restore Application.

6. Follow the on-screen instructions.

8. When prompted, select on "Full Factory Recovery"

9. Select Next >> Yes.

10. After a couple of minutes the recovery will be completed.

if that doesnt work there should also be a hidden recovery partition--may have to turn on hdd recovery in the bios--usually pressing something like fn + f12 accesses the recovery partition but different manufacturers use different keys

another option is if you can boot into windows there should be toshiba software on it to make your own dvds
